Massive Rescued Spider Gains Internet Fame, Time to Curl Up in Fear

A colossal spider rescue has taken the internet by storm, prompting a wave of dread among viewers. Amid various global crises, few Americans are likely to consider relocating to Australia, a country notorious for its unnerving wildlife, including spiders that resemble household pets. Recently, a story surfaced about a giant spider that has gripped the online community, sending many into a state of panic.

Located in the Brisbane Valley of Queensland, the Barnyard Betty’s Rescue organization recently saved this enormous creature from an unfortunate fate at the hands of someone who desired to exterminate it. The photo of this spider has resurfaced and is now going viral, further solidifying Australia’s reputation as a land of nightmares. Dubbed “Charlotte,” this Huntsman spider is a true marvel of nature, albeit a terrifying one.

Upon seeing Charlotte, your instinct may be to scream “NO WAY!” or question the very existence of such a large spider. Why does something like this need to exist in the natural world? Though there are no easy answers, the rescue group attempts to portray her in a more favorable light. “She’s a beautiful, docile spider who’s not aggressive at all. Like most spiders, she just wants to eat bugs and live peacefully. There’s no reason for her to be killed! Poor spiders are often misunderstood!” they state.

While they might present Charlotte as harmless, recent viral videos of Huntsman spiders dragging dead mice have left many skeptical. A spider, hauling a mouse? That hardly screams “harmless” to anyone! Further research reveals that these eight-legged creatures are adept hunters, capable of sprinting at speeds up to a yard per second—far too fast for comfort.

Typically, Huntsman spiders can reach sizes comparable to dinner plates, and while Charlotte seems to be a particularly large specimen, the average size is around five inches. This monstrous creature, however, appears to be at least double that dimension.

Despite her intimidating appearance, the research suggests that Huntsman spiders primarily feast on insects and only carry around deceased mice for sport. So while Charlotte may leave lasting emotional scars, she’s unlikely to pose a lethal threat while we sleep. Although the thought of her crawling across our faces in the dead of night is unsettling, it’s comforting to know she won’t be actively hunting humans.
